Notas da Release do Data Flow Dependency Packager

Saiba mais sobre as alterações em cada versão do empacotador de dependências de terceiros.

Release 2.4.0

  • Lançado: Apr 19, 2024
  • Atualize o Python versão para 3.11.
  • Atualize o pip para o Python 3.11 mais recente.
  • Suporta a compilação de Manifestos de Arquitetura Múltipla para arm64 e amd64.
  • Compatível com versões anteriores do arquivador da versão do Spark para as versões suportadas do python.

Release 2.3.1

  • Lançado: Jun 08, 2023
  • Atualize o pip para o Python 3.6 e 3.8 mais recente.
  • Instale o pacote python-devel para Python 3.8.
  • Suporta a compilação de Manifestos de Arquitetura Múltipla para arm64 e amd64.

Release 2.2.0

  • Lançado: Mar 24, 2022
  • Release dependency-packager:2.2.0 at phx.ocir.io/oracle/dataflow/dependency-packager:2.2.0 e tag como mais recente.
  • Opção de suporte --validate <archive_file> para validar o arquivo compactado localmente.

Release 2.1.0

  • Lançado: Feb 19, 2022
  • Release dependency-packager:2.1.0 at phx.ocir.io/oracle/dataflow/dependency-packager:2.1.0 e tag como mais recente.
  • Adicione suporte de Python 3.8.11 para dependências. Deve especificar a versão do Python (3.6 ou 3.8) usando a opção -p no arquivo requirements.txt.

Release 2.0.0

  • Lançado: Nov 07, 2021
  • Alteração principal que usa o resolvedor do Ivy de spark-core para fazer download de dependências, em vez de Maven.
  • Suporte packages.txt para ser compatível com versões anteriores com 1.0.x para aplicativos Java.
  • Suporte a --packages na CLI spark-submit para fazer download de dependências.
  • Suporte --exclude-packages da CLI spark-submit para excluir determinadas dependências.

Release 1.0.4

  • Lançado: Oct 20, 2021
  • Release dependency-packager:1.0.4 at phx.ocir.io/oracle/dataflow/dependency-packager:1.0.4 e tag como mais recente.
  • Remova o arquivo pom restante do aplicativo Java.
  • Corrija o problema de tag de exclusão duplicada para a ferramenta de empacotador de dependência.
  • Trate a última linha sem nova linha para o arquivo requirements.txt.

Release 1.0.3

  • Lançado: Sep 21, 2021
  • Release dependency-packager:1.0.3 at phx.ocir.io/oracle/dataflow/dependency-packager:1.0.3 e tag como mais recente.
  • Tratar pacotes que não têm informações de versão.

Release 1.0.2

  • Lançado: Apr 06, 2021
  • Release dependency-packager:1.0.2 at phx.ocir.io/oracle/dataflow/dependency-packager:1.0.2 e tag como mais recente.
  • Reduza o tamanho da imagem e instale bibliotecas do repositório yum.

Release 1.0.1

  • Lançado: Jan 06, 2021
  • Release dependency-packager:1.0.1 at phx.ocir.io/oracle/dataflow/dependency-packager:1.0.1 e tag como mais recente.
  • Remova pip, pip3 do arquivo archive.zip gerado.